/* LANDINGS PAGINA */

#detail-intro {
	padding:10px 10px 6px;
}
#detail-intro h1,
#detail-intro h2 {
	color:#010728;
	float:left;
	width:auto;
	font-size:1.5em;
}
#detail-intro h2 a {
	font-weight:bold;
	text-decoration:none;
	color:#010728;
}
.d-right {
	float:right !important;
	width:auto;
}
.d-right h2{
	display:inline;
	width:auto;
}
#detail-intro a:hover {
	color:#71920B;
}

.header-detail { background:#010728; margin-top:3px; padding:10px; }
.header-detail P { color:#FFF; float:left; font-size:1em; width:50%; }
.header-detail P A { color:#FFF; padding:3px; text-decoration:none; }
.header-detail P A:HOVER { background:#FFF; color:#010728; }

.detail-1 ul,
.detail-2 ul {
	cursor:pointer;
	margin-top:3px;
	list-style:none;
}
.detail-1 ul li,
.detail-2 ul li {
	margin-right:3px;
	float:left;
}
.detail-1 ul li {
	background:#e8dbb3;
}
.detail-2 ul li {
	background:#f4e9ce;
}
.d-pic {
	text-align:center;
	width:141px;
	height:113px;
}
.d-pic img{
	margin-top:10px;
}
.d-titel {
	font-size:1.2em;
	/*line-height:16px;*/
	padding:10px;
	width:239px;
	height:93px;
	
}
.d-detail {
	font-size:1.2em;
	line-height:18px;
	padding:10px;
	width:316px;
	height:93px;
}
.d-detail strong {
	display:block;
	color:#111942;
}
.d-detail a {
	font-weight:bold;
	text-decoration:none;
	color:#010728;
}
.d-detail a:hover {
	color:#71920B;
}
.d-price {
	font-size:1.2em;
	line-height:18px;
	height:93px;
	width:191px;
	padding:10px;
	margin-right:0px !important;
}
.d-price strong {
	color:#111942;
}


/* DETAIL PAGINA */
#detail-left {
	width:292px;
	float:left;
}
#detail-main {
	width:639px;
	float:right;
}
#detail-pand, #detail-specs, #detail-fotos {
	margin:20px 0 5px;
	background:url(../img/detail-left.gif) no-repeat top left ;

}
#detail-pand { height:210px; text-align:center; }
#detail-pand img{
	margin-top:10px;
}
#detail-pand strong {
	color:#71920B;
	display:block;
	padding:5px 0pt;
}
#detail-specs dl {
	padding:10px 0 0 10px;
	list-style:none;
	height:110px;
}
#detail-specs dl dt {
	float:left;
	clear:left;
	padding:1px 5px;
	width:120px;
	color:#111942;
	font-weight:bold;
	margin:2px 0;
}
#detail-specs dl dd {
	float:left;
	padding:1px 5px;
	width:100px;
	margin:2px 0;
}
#detail-fotos {
	height:100px;
	padding:5px 0 0 5px;
}
html > body #detail-fotos {
	min-height:100px;
	height:auto;
}
#detail-fotos a{
	display:block;
	float:left;
	margin:10px 0 0 10px;
}

#detail-main #subnavy {
	list-style:none;
	height:21px;
	border-bottom:1px solid #010728;
}
#detail-main #subnavy li {
	float:left;
	display:block;
}
#detail-main #subnavy li a {
	text-decoration:none;
	margin-right:5px;
	border:1px solid #010728;
	padding:3px 10px;
	display:block;
	color:#000;
}
#detail-main #subnavy li a:hover {
	border:1px solid #71920b;
	border-bottom:1px solid #010728;
	color:#71920b;
}
#detail-main #subnavy li.active a {
	background:#f4e9ce;
	border-bottom:1px solid #F4E9CE;
}
#detail-main #subnavy li.active a:hover {
	border:1px solid #010728;
	border-bottom:1px solid #f4e9ce;
	color:#010728;
}
#detail-content {
	background:#f4e9ce;
	border:1px solid #010728;
	border-top:0px;
	padding:0px 0px 20px 0px;
}
#detail-content h3 {
	padding:15px 15px 0px;
	font-size:1.5em;
	color:#111942;
}
#detail-content p {
	padding:0px 15px;
	font-size:1em;
	line-height:18px;
}
#detail-content dl {
	
}
#detail-content dl dt {
	clear:left;
	float:left;
	padding:3px 3px 3px 22px;
	width:144px;
}
#detail-content dl dd {
	float:left;
	padding:3px;
	width:462px;
}
#detail-content dl .dt-bg {
	background:#ebdfbb;
}

#slideshow {
	background:#AF9D7D;
	width:575px;
	margin:0 auto;
	border:10px solid #af9d7d;
	text-align:center;
}
#slideshow img {
}
#slideshow-thumbs {
	width:595px;
	margin:0 auto;
}
#slideshow-thumbs a{
	display:block;
	float:left;
	width:auto;
	border:3px solid #F4E9CE;
}
#slideshow-control {
	background:#AF9D7D url(../img/btn-pause.gif) center center no-repeat;
	cursor:pointer;
	display:block;
	float:right;
	width:25px;
	height:25px;
	margin-right:21px;
	margin-top:23px;
}
#slideshow-text {
	float:right;
	color:#010728;
	margin:28px 4px 0 0;
}

A.no_style, A.no_style A{
	border:0 !important; padding:0 !important;
	padding-bottom: 4px !important;	
	text-decoration: none !important;
}

LI A.addthis_counter.addthis_bubble_style {width: 36px!important;}
DIV#search{width:100%; margin: 10px 15px 0 0;}
DIV#search select{width:125px; font-size:11px;}
DIV#search input[type=submit]{float:left;padding: 0 10px;}
DIV#search DIV.search_field{width:23%; float:left;height: 25px;}
DIV#search DIV.search_field2{width:23%; float:left;height: 25px;}
DIV#search LABEL{width:55px; float:left;font-weight:bold;}

